``threaded_engine_create/3``
============================

Description
-----------

::

   threaded_engine_create(AnswerTemplate, Goal, Engine)

Creates a new engine for proving the given goal and defines an answer
template for retrieving the goal solution bindings. A message queue for
passing arbitrary terms to the engine is also created. If the name for
the engine is not given, a unique name is generated and returned. Engine
names shall be regarded as opaque terms; users shall not rely on its
type.

Modes and number of proofs
--------------------------

::

   threaded_engine_create(@term, @callable, @nonvar) - one
   threaded_engine_create(@term, @callable, --nonvar) - one

Errors
------

| ``Goal`` is a variable:
|     ``instantiation_error``
| ``Goal`` is neither a variable nor a callable term:
|     ``type_error(callable, Goal)``
| ``Engine`` is the name of an existing engine:
|     ``permission_error(create, engine, Engine)``

Examples
--------

::

   % create a new engine for finding members of a list:
   | ?- threaded_engine_create(X, member(X, [1,2,3]), worker_1).
